  18. Big surprise, very big. Olympia Snowe, first elected to the Senate in 1994, is not going to run for a fourth term. Here is her statement on why. http://livewire.talkingpointsmemo.com/entries/snowe-statement-on-decision-not-to-run-for?ref=fpblg The Maine GOP has become dominated by extremists like Paul LePage, but I think she probably would have won a fourth term. I can believe that she was just sick of the partisanship that has poisoned Congress. This makes for a very competitive race. Both major parties in Maine are broken and struggle to provide strong nominees. LePage only won because of a split between Democrats and independents, and many voters regret letting him in as governor. Yet I don't think there are any strong Democrats in contention here - Mike Michaud, one Congressman, is pro-life (not a good fit statewide), and the other Congresswoman I haven't heard a lot about. Republicans also seem to have few likely choices for nominees.
